Output 3c1c0a78225b11db33b4f6d25f6a9d6c998837db3a74ec7b2a238c129c4674bc:3

value
21154034287
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a869e3c78fb1352fc45af00ef2a5121ecf2724c OP_EQUAL
address
MBn1svAC2Ad9oM3HAz6wzgCEeyBAWgzkJt
transaction
3c1c0a78225b11db33b4f6d25f6a9d6c998837db3a74ec7b2a238c129c4674bc
spent
true